Need for Professional Waterproofing in Rangitikei

Homeowners in Rangitikei understand the importance of maintaining a dry, secure living space. With its temperate maritime climate, the region experiences its fair share of wet winters and dry summers, which can be taxing on homes. This is where professional waterproofing becomes invaluable. Whether it’s addressing rising damp, leaky basements, or sealing roofs against the New Zealand rain, having a good waterproofing professional may be essential for the longevity of your property.

Importance of Experienced Waterproofers

Waterproofing is a specialised field that requires distinct skills and knowledge. Professionals in this trade often come from a background in construction or the building industry, and their understanding of structural mechanics can be a key asset in diagnosing and resolving water issues. In Rangitikei, where the architectural styles vary from traditional villas to modern lofts with open floor plans, these experts ensure that each unique structure receives the appropriate treatment, adhering to New Zealand's Building Code for moisture control.

Planning Your Waterproofing Project

Initiating a waterproofing project begins with accurately identifying your needs. Homes in Rangitikei may suffer from a range of issues, including basement water ingress, roof leakage, or inadequate drainage. A waterproofing professional might assess your situation, propose a comprehensive solution, and help prevent future water-related problems. Solutions might include sealing, improved drainage systems, or even structural repairs. Engaging early with professionals can ensure that you make informed decisions tailored to your home's specific requirements.

Weather Challenges in Rangitikei

Rangitikei's unique weather conditions can influence the timing and method of waterproofing projects. Winter frosts and strong winds present significant challenges, potentially delaying outdoor work due to safety risks and the technical constraints of applying materials. On the other hand, the warm and dry summer months offer a more conducive environment for waterproofing tasks. Planning your project with these factors in mind can optimise the effectiveness and longevity of the treatments applied.
